Features
Extremely low equivalent on-resistance; RCE(sat)44mÙ at 5A. 7 Amp continuous collector current (20 Amp peak). Very low saturation voltages. Excellent gain charateristics specified upto 20 Amp. Ptot = 3 Watts.
